Output fc53e79dc3a875e0bae410fae1ebd8d56d9915a773f8e59caf1c54165e85133a:2

value
77053308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30ba20d80ca1096b76b32ef1436c31a68ede3122 OP_EQUAL
address
MCLoe4N89uWcrDCwLNXJcZhSk6gJXssMBh
transaction
fc53e79dc3a875e0bae410fae1ebd8d56d9915a773f8e59caf1c54165e85133a
spent
true